Property Description for 132 East 65th Street, 3-A

Manhattan's Best 3 bedroom, 3 bath Condominium on the Upper East Side, close to Central Park! For those who seek the absolute finest in Upper East Side living, this spectacular 1,853sf.* (172sm*), 3 bedroom, 3 bath home at The Touraine Condominium is a once-in-a-lifetime opportunity to experience the epitome of luxury in a 5-star location. For the discerning buyer with high expectations, this designer decorated masterpiece does not disappoint. The entryway features a custom closet and beautiful white marble flooring. The exquisitely-designed separate kitchen integrates custom millwork cabinetry, Italian Calacatta marble counter tops, Gaggenau appliances and a Sub Zero ® refrigerator. The master bathroom is brilliantly-crafted, with Waterworks fixtures, large soaking tub, custom millwork vanities, and beautiful Italian Calacatta and Arctic gray marble. This ultra-luxurious home also features 9'6'' ceilings, solid white oak herringbone flooring with custom stain, stackable washer/dryer and abundant light. As an added bonus, there is a 421-A tax abatement in place until 2023, allowing for incredibly low taxes of only $379/month. Situated on the southeast corner of 65th Street and Lexington Avenue, The Touraine is one of the rare new construction developments that exist in the area. Completed in 2013, this respected work of art features 22 highly-coveted condominium residences. Boutique in nature and ambiance, The Touraine combines the intimacy of a private home with the convenience of a full-service, amenity-rich building: 24-hour doorman and concierge service, resident library, traditional wine cellar with private wine lockers for residents, impeccably-maintained fitness center, and a landscaped roof-top terrace with an open-air fireplace and picturesque views. Residents may also take advantage of additional conveniences such as refrigerated storage, bicycle storage and personal storage containers. The Lexington Avenue Line is only 3 blocks north on 68th Street. Residents also benefit from close proximity to Central Park and an impressive array of gastronomy and Madison Avenue retail boutiques, including Philippe, Serafina, Harry Cipriani, Barney's, Hermes, Anne Fontaine and Agent Provocateur.

Upper East Side | Manhattan

Quick Profile

Exuding a cosmopolitan, refined air that is reminiscent of Paris or other European cities, the Upper East Side (the UES, to local cognoscenti) has a reputation as being a bastion of wealth and privilege. Even though it was built by American “royalty” families like the Vanderbilts, Roosevelts, Kennedys, Carnegies and Rockefellers, whose elaborate mansions once anchored Fifth Avenue, there are affordable housing options throughout the neighborhood. The further east you move, away from Central Park and the more commercial avenues, the more likely you are to find quiet, tree-lined streets with historic townhouses and brownstones. Keep your eye out for reasonably priced apartments in pre-war low-rise and even a few high-rise buildings.

With abundant, beautifully landscaped green spaces, including the oasis of Central Park acting like a backyard, the area is quiet and lushly green. You can relax and unwind in John Jay Park, Carl Schurz Park or take a stroll along the East River Promenade. The whole neighborhood seems isolated from the workaday chaos of the city at large. Add to that the history of the neighborhood and the abundance of cultural institutions, and you have a uniquely welcoming neighborhood.

Known for its abundance of high-end retail shopping, especially on Madison Avenue, the Upper East Side is host to the Barneys New York flagship department store. Here you can find upscale goods, fashion and home decor items. You will also find the edgy runway-inspired Alexander McQueen collections. If you are dying to treat your feet to red-soled opulence, be sure to visit the Christian Louboutin boutique. These are only a small sampling of this high-end shopper’s paradise that features everything from designer boutiques that offer the ultimate in haute couture to resale shops where you can find last season’s best on sale at hefty discounts .

There are many unique dining experiences, from fine dining to the casual bite-on-the-go, awaiting you in the UES. Sushi is going through a renaissance in the city, and the best omakase-style sushi can be found at Sasabune on E 73rd Street. Omakase sushi means that you leave the choice of ingredients, preparation method and presentation to the chef. Elegant French cuisine can be experienced at JoJo, E 64th Street, housed in gorgeous townhouse. Just for fun, visit the Lexington Candy Shop on Lexington Avenue, to get a taste of an old-fashioned soda fountain.
